Tool #1: Video Editing Automation with InShot

One of the most time-consuming tasks as a food vlogger is video editing. From trimming clips to adding music and effects, editing can eat up hours of your day. That’s where InShot comes in. This tool automates many aspects of the video editing process, allowing you to create professional-looking videos without spending too much time on technical edits.

Features of InShot
  • Pre-set Filters & Effects: Instantly apply filters to your footage and add effects that elevate your content.
  • Audio Integration: Easily add background music or sound effects, saving you from manually syncing everything.
  • Transitions: Use smooth transitions between clips to give your videos a polished, professional feel.
How InShot Can Streamline Your Workflow

InShot’s features like automated transitions, pre-set templates, and filters help you minimize the effort involved in editing. Tool #2: Social Media Scheduling with Buffer

As a food vlogger, maintaining a consistent social media presence is key to growing your audience. But posting regularly on Instagram, Facebook, or Twitter can be time-consuming, especially when you’re trying to manage multiple accounts. Enter Buffer, an app designed to automate your social media scheduling, saving you hours of manual posting.

Why You Should Use Buffer for Scheduling

Buffer allows you to schedule posts across various social media platforms, ensuring your content goes out at the optimal times. It also lets you manage multiple accounts from a single dashboard, so you won’t need to hop from app to app just to post a new update. If you’re looking to grow your reach and visibility, Buffer is the tool for you.

Automating Your Social Media Content with Buffer

To start automating your social media posts with Buffer:

  1. Connect your social media profiles.
  2. Upload your content (images, videos, text).
  3. Set your preferred posting schedule.
  4. Buffer takes care of posting at the right time, every time.

Tool #3: Streamlining Content Creation with Trello

Organizing your content can be a challenge, especially when you’re juggling multiple projects at once. Trello is the ultimate tool for managing your content creation workflow. It helps you visualize your projects, keep track of deadlines, and automate task management.

Benefits of Using Trello for Food Vloggers

Trello helps you break down your projects into smaller tasks. Create boards for different stages of your content creation process, from brainstorming ideas to filming and editing. You can even collaborate with other creators or team members, ensuring everyone is on the same page.

Automating Tasks and Deadlines with Trello

Tool #4: Managing YouTube Content with TubeBuddy

If you’re serious about growing your YouTube channel, TubeBuddy is an essential tool for automating many aspects of managing your content. From optimizing your video titles and descriptions to analyzing your video performance, TubeBuddy takes the guesswork out of growing your channel.

Why TubeBuddy is Essential for Food Vloggers

TubeBuddy helps improve your SEO by suggesting the best keywords for your videos. It also helps with bulk editing, video analytics, and keeping track of your video performance over time.

Streamlining YouTube Video Uploads

TubeBuddy simplifies the video upload process by allowing you to edit and optimize multiple videos at once. It also helps with tag and description management, saving you time when posting new videos. If you’re looking to improve your video SEO, TubeBuddy is your go-to tool.


Tool #5: Content Planning and SEO with SEMrush

Planning content and ensuring it ranks well on search engines is crucial for long-term success as a food vlogger. SEMrush helps you automate keyword research, track your SEO efforts, and plan your content more strategically.

Key SEMrush Features for Food Vloggers
  • Keyword Research: SEMrush provides keyword suggestions based on your niche, helping your content rank higher.
  • SEO Audits: The tool helps you identify SEO issues and fix them.
  • Competitor Analysis: See what’s working for your competitors and adjust your content accordingly.
Automating SEO and Content Strategy with SEMrush

SEMrush automates the process of tracking keywords, generating content ideas, and optimizing your posts. By using SEMrush for SEO research and content planning, you can drive more organic traffic to your videos and blog posts. Tool #6: Streamlining Email Marketing with Mailchimp

Email marketing is an incredibly effective way to stay in touch with your audience, but it can take up a lot of time to send out newsletters and promotions manually. Mailchimp automates the process of creating and sending marketing emails, so you can focus on creating content instead of managing your email list.

Why Mailchimp is Perfect for Food Vloggers

Mailchimp allows you to send automated welcome emails, new video alerts, and regular newsletters to your subscribers. You can segment your audience and tailor your messages to specific groups, increasing engagement.

Automating Newsletters and Promotions with Mailchimp

Tool #7: Workflow Integration with Zapier

If you use multiple tools for your food vlogging business, Zapier is a game-changer. Zapier automates workflows between apps, saving you time by connecting different platforms and reducing manual work.

How Zapier Works for Food Vloggers

Zapier connects over 2,000 apps, including Google Sheets, YouTube, Trello, and Mailchimp, to automate tasks between them. For example, you can automatically save email attachments to Google Drive or share your latest YouTube video on social media without lifting a finger.

Streamlining Your Food Vlogging Workflow with Zapier
